v8 eater Posted March 1, 2012 Share Posted March 1, 2012 (edited) get this tool with it mate, coz its gonna be a bitch to take out.. youll need to get around the wire and the only tool u can use is this i reckon.. spanners wont fit and its always seized up so u will have to use a lot of torque to take it out.. I had to hammer then large wrench i had to create enough torque to leave it come undone.. you will also find WD40 handy and a warm engines always good.. http://www.kudosmoto...22mm-p-640.html its pretty staright forward if you know where the sensor is.. if u dont, let me know and ill point you to it, so all u do is warm engine up spray wd40 fit socket (link posted above) onto sensor and try to loosen it out.. once its out, disconnect the plug at the other end replace sensor with the new one (screw it in place and plug in the connection) Edited March 1, 2012 by v8 eater Link to comment https://www.sau.com.au/forums/topic/392582-looks-like-a-faulty-02-sensor-new-member/#findComment-6258044 Share on other sites More sharing options...

madmatsmadhouse Posted May 11, 2012 Author Share Posted May 11, 2012 (edited) i ended up getting the sensor. as people said yes the sr20 sensor works:D.. the ntk part number is - 0ZA395-E2 only thing was i had to use my original plug. just crimped the ends from the new sensor with the plug that came off the original one out of the car. oh and it was only $62.. bit better the $200 for the oem sensor thanks for the help guys..
